Silksong Easter egg hides a secret, super-hard permadeath mode, for individuals who wish to endure much more

Hole Knight: Silksong will get a bit simpler subsequent week with the discharge of the sport’s first patch, which amongst different issues guarantees a “slight issue discount in early recreation bosses Moorwing and Sister Splinter.” However what if, for some demented motive, you wished to make the sport tougher? Because it seems, that is on the menu too, and you do not even have to attend for it.

Metal Soul mode is a permadeath mode that turns into out there within the authentic Hole Knight after finishing the sport for the primary time, and it does certainly make the sport tougher: Simply as in actual life, demise just isn’t a situation from which one can get better. Metal Soul mode can be current in Silksong, revealed by the presence of the Metal Soul achievement on Steam.

However as found by redditor Buttnugtaster—man, I really like quoting redditors in information tales—the Metal Soul mode in Silksong just isn’t restricted to replays. By going to the “Extras” menu and getting into Up, Down, Up, Down, Left, Proper, Left, Proper in your controller, you’ll be able to unlock the Metal Soul mode instantly.

I am certain it isn’t gone missed, however this unlock, minus a pair button presses, comes by the use of the Konami code, a cheat code created by Kazuhisa Hashimoto in 1985 to help with recreation growth that subsequently broke containment and appeared in quite a few different video games over time. All due respect to IDDQD die-hards, however the Konami code is way and away probably the most well-known cheat code in videogame historical past, and its use on this little Easter egg is a pleasant contact.

For the document, I examined this myself, and yup, it really works. I fired up Silksong, went straight to the “Extras” menu, bashed within the code, the display screen flashed and gave me a little bit of a boooosh sound, and Metal Soul was then out there when beginning a brand new recreation.

I may affirm that whereas the Konami code is historically utilized with a controller, it really works simply as effectively in Silksong with a keyboard.
